8 Top-Rated Online Spanish Classes to Master the Language

Learning a new language can open doors to new cultures, enhance your travel experiences, and even boost your career.

If you’ve decided to learn Spanish, you’ve made an excellent choice. Spanish is one of the most widely spoken languages in the world and offers numerous benefits for personal and professional growth.

With the growing demand for flexible learning solutions, online Spanish classes have become an effective and convenient way to master the language.

This article will guide you through eight top-rated online Spanish classes, helping you find the best fit for your learning style and goals.

1) Baselang

Baselang offers unlimited Spanish classes for a monthly fee of $179.

You can choose from over 450 native teachers from Latin America.

This makes it easy to find a teacher that fits your learning style.

The program started in 2015 and has since grown to serve over 10,000 students.

Baselang uses custom learning materials to help you progress faster.

They focus on immersive learning, which means you get to practice speaking Spanish from day one.

One of the perks of Baselang is the $1 trial week.

This allows you to test out the service without committing to a full month.

If you like it, you can continue; if not, you’ve only spent a dollar.

Baselang also offers different modes like the Real World program, which provides unlimited one-on-one online tutoring.

This flexibility makes it easier for you to fit learning into your schedule.

Classes can be paused or canceled at any time, giving you complete control over your learning journey.

However, some users have mentioned that their favorite teachers are often booked up, which can be frustrating.

Yet, with a large pool of teachers, you generally have options available.

If you’re looking for a reliable online Spanish class, Baselang might be a good fit.

Their consistent pricing and quality teaching make it a strong candidate for anyone serious about learning Spanish.

2) Lingoda

Lingoda offers top-notch Spanish classes online.

All instructors are native speakers and highly qualified.

The program follows the CEFR guideline, which means it covers levels from A1 to B2.

This makes it suitable for beginners and those looking to reach advanced levels.

Classes are structured to help you progress smoothly.

The Lingoda method ensures a consistent learning experience.

With a focus on speaking, you can gain confidence quickly.

Lingoda also offers an intensive Spanish course.

This program is designed for those who want to learn Spanish faster.

You can join daily lessons and see noticeable improvements in a short time.

Another benefit is the small class sizes, typically with 1-5 adult students.

This allows for more personalized instruction and interaction.

Whether you aim to learn Spanish for travel, work, or personal enrichment, Lingoda provides diverse options.

Though their curriculum covers fewer languages compared to some other platforms, Lingoda is expanding.

They recently added an Italian curriculum in 2024, showing their commitment to growth.

If you’re ready to start your journey, you can check out Lingoda’s Spanish courses to find the right fit for your goals.

3) SpanishVIP

SpanishVIP offers online Spanish classes tailored to your needs.

You can choose from unlimited group classes or private tutoring.

Classes are available from 6am to 10pm EST, making it easy to fit lessons into your schedule.

The teachers at SpanishVIP focus on helping you understand each lesson.

This approach makes learning Spanish both easy and fun.

You can take as many classes as you need to achieve your goals.

SpanishVIP offers private plans starting from $129 per month, with a six-month plan costing up to $699.

These plans provide flexibility for learners with busy schedules.

If you prefer learning in groups, SpanishVIP’s group classes allow you to access a wide range of curriculum materials.

You can study using guides, interactive videos, and audio activities.

The self-led academy is available 24/7.

SpanishVIP also provides special offers for new students.

Current group class students can gift 2-weeks free to a new student by contacting the support team.

Additionally, new group class students get 50% off their first year of classes.

For more details, you can visit the SpanishVIP – Online Spanish Classes page.

Make sure to check out their group class options here.

4) FluentU

FluentU uses authentic videos to teach Spanish.

You can watch movies, music videos, and news clips that native speakers use.

This helps you learn natural speech and get used to hearing the language as it’s actually spoken.

The program adapts to your learning pace.

It offers different types of exercises to improve your listening, speaking, reading, and writing skills.

FluentU is flexible, allowing you to study anywhere and anytime.

You can use it on your computer, tablet, or smartphone, making it great for busy schedules.

You have a choice to start with a free trial.

After that, the cost ranges from $11.99 to $29.99 per month.

This makes it accessible to many learners.

For more detailed information, you can check FluentU’s Spanish course page.

FluentU stands out by providing context-rich learning.

Each video comes with interactive subtitles.

You can click on any word to see its meaning, example sentences, and pronunciation.

The program also offers built-in quizzes.

These quizzes help reinforce what you’ve learned from the videos.

This way, your practice feels both intuitive and engaging.

Reviewing vocabulary is made easy with FluentU’s spaced repetition system.

Words and phrases are reviewed at increasing intervals to help them stick in your memory.

FluentU’s content is updated regularly.

This keeps your learning material fresh and relevant.

You’ll always have new videos to watch and new vocab to learn.

If you enjoy interactive and video-based learning, FluentU could be a good fit.

It combines entertainment and education seamlessly.

This approach makes language learning more engaging and less monotonous.

Using FluentU can help improve your Spanish in a way that’s both effective and enjoyable.

5) Rocket Spanish

Rocket Spanish is designed to guide you from basic to advanced Spanish.

The course structure is divided into 22 modules, each with multiple lessons.

The lessons are interactive.

They focus on audio, language, and culture, making it easy to get a well-rounded education.

You’ll find both the audio course and software user-friendly.

They allow you to learn Spanish at your own pace.

One of the highlights is the “survival kit” exercises.

These exercises cover essential phrases and vocabulary, ensuring you can handle real-life situations.

The course also includes community support.

You get the chance to interact with teachers and fellow learners, boosting your practice and confidence.

Rocket Spanish is perfect if you prefer structured learning.

It offers a clear progression from beginner to advanced levels, all in one platform.

To start, you can try the free trial and see if it fits your learning style.

The trial includes various lessons to give you a feel for the program.

6) Rosetta Stone

Rosetta Stone has been a prominent name in language learning since 1992.

It uses a method called “Dynamic Immersion,” which teaches vocabulary and grammar through images, text, and sounds without translations.

The program is known for its structured approach, making it easy to follow.

It covers everything from basic words to advanced phrases.

Rosetta Stone is suitable for different learning levels.

One of its main strengths is pronunciation practice.

It uses speech recognition technology to help you improve your accents.

This feature is very beneficial for mastering pronunciation.

Rosetta Stone offers a variety of subscription plans.

You can choose from a monthly, yearly, or lifetime subscription.

It also provides a three-day trial to help you decide if it’s the right fit.

Another advantage is its mobile app.

The app allows you to learn on the go, making it convenient for busy schedules.

The interface is user-friendly and syncs with your progress on other devices.

Rosetta Stone supports multiple languages.

If you decide to learn another language, you can easily switch without purchasing a new subscription.

This flexibility can be useful for multilingual learners.

However, you may find some limitations.

For example, the lack of translation can be challenging if you’re a beginner.

It might also be less engaging than some modern apps with gamified learning experiences.

Despite these points, Rosetta Stone remains a solid choice for structured and comprehensive Spanish learning.

It is trusted by many users for a good reason.

7) Babbel

A colorful classroom with a computer, textbooks, and a whiteboard displaying "Babbel 8 Top-Rated Online Spanish Classes."

Babbel offers a well-rounded course for learning Spanish.

It focuses on conversation practice, while also improving your reading, writing, and listening skills.

You can choose classes based on your level and your favorite topics among hundreds of options.

The courses cover a wide range of real-life topics, making your learning experience relevant and practical.

Babbel provides a high level of flexibility with bite-sized class sizes.

This makes it easy to fit learning into your schedule.

Classes are available 24/7, and you can book them on short notice, although the best selection may be three days out.

Every Babbel Live subscription also includes free access to the Babbel App.

This helps you continue boosting your Spanish skills on the go. Babbel Live’s online Spanish classes are designed to meet the needs of learners at all levels.

The platform includes engaging drills and exercises.

For instance, beginner levels cover daily life topics with various courses and lessons.

These short, interactive lessons keep you engaged and motivated.

Babbel’s design and learning methods stand out.

The platform integrates reading, listening, and speaking lessons that make it one of the best options for learning Spanish.

If you are looking for a platform that combines flexibility and comprehensive learning, Babbel Spanish is worth considering.

8) Italki

Italki is a popular platform where you can learn Spanish through one-on-one lessons.

The platform offers nearly 3,000 Spanish tutors from around the world.

You can read about each tutor and watch their introductory videos to get an idea of their teaching style and methods.

Lessons on Italki are tailored to your interests and language goals.

Whether you are a beginner or looking to become fluent, you can find a tutor who meets your needs.

The flexibility of scheduling lessons at your own pace is a big advantage.

The cost of lessons varies based on the tutor you choose.

This allows you to pick a tutor that fits your budget.

You can also check reviews and ratings left by other students, which helps in deciding which tutor to go with.

Besides personalized lessons, Italki also offers various language resources.

You can benefit from interactive exercises, language exchange partners, and community discussions.

These additional tools make your learning experience more comprehensive.

For more information, you can visit Italki’s blog on the best online Spanish classes or explore their full list of resources.

If you are looking for a platform that combines tutor variety and budget options, Italki might be the best choice for your Spanish learning journey.

Benefits of Online Spanish Classes

A laptop displaying a virtual Spanish class with a teacher and students, surrounded by language books and cultural decorations

Online Spanish classes offer a range of advantages that make learning convenient and effective.

You can study at your own pace, have access to native speakers, and enjoy flexible schedules that fit your lifestyle.

Flexibility and Convenience

One of the biggest benefits of online Spanish classes is flexibility.

You can schedule lessons around your daily routine, whether that’s early in the morning, late at night, or during lunch breaks.

This flexibility is especially useful for people with busy lives.

You also don’t have to commute, saving you time and money.

You can join classes from anywhere—your home, a café, or even while traveling.

Additionally, many platforms offer on-demand video lectures, allowing you to learn whenever it’s most convenient for you.

Personalized Learning Pace

With online Spanish classes, you can learn at your own pace.

Traditional classroom settings often move too quickly or too slowly.

Online courses let you spend more time on challenging topics and breeze through easier ones, making the learning experience more efficient.

You can choose from various course types, such as intensive courses for quick progress, or more relaxed courses for a leisurely learning experience.

Some classes even offer progress tracking to help you identify areas that need improvement.

Access to Native Speakers

Many online Spanish classes connect you with native speakers, providing an authentic learning experience.

Speaking with native speakers helps improve your pronunciation, listening skills, and gives you insights into the culture.

Moreover, platforms like Preply and Coursera often have a wide range of tutors.

You can choose tutors based on their experience, teaching style, and availability.

This access ensures you get diverse language exposure, making your learning more comprehensive.

Choosing the Right Online Spanish Class

When picking an online Spanish class, consider factors like accreditation, reviews, class format, curriculum, pricing, and subscription options.

These details can help you find the best class for your needs and preferences.

Accreditation and Reviews

Accreditation assures you that the class meets certain quality standards.

Look for classes recognized by educational institutions or language organizations.

Reviews from other students can give you insights into the program’s effectiveness and quality.

Check websites like Preply and e-student to read feedback and see ratings.

Key Points:

  • Validates course quality
  • Provides real user experiences
  • Helps identify popular options

Class Format and Curriculum

Class format varies from self-paced to live lessons.

Choose the one that suits your schedule and learning style.

Curriculum structure is also crucial.

It should be comprehensive, covering speaking, listening, reading, and writing skills.

Programs like Rocket Spanish offer structured learning paths from basic to advanced levels.

Considerations:

  • Self-paced vs. live classes
  • Comprehensive skill coverage
  • Structured learning paths

Pricing and Subscription Options

Pricing can range from free courses to subscription-based models.

Evaluate your budget and compare different options.

Subscriptions can offer various perks.

For instance, Coursera’s “Coursera Plus” provides unlimited access for an annual fee.

Look for both short-term and long-term plans to find the best value.

Points to Note:

  • Free vs. paid options
  • Subscription benefits
  • Short-term and long-term plans

Tips for Success in Online Spanish Learning

A laptop displaying top-rated Spanish classes, surrounded by books, a globe, and a cup of coffee on a desk

Learning Spanish online is convenient and effective if approached correctly.

To make the most out of your studies, focus on setting achievable goals, practicing regularly, and using additional learning tools.

Here’s how you can succeed in your online Spanish learning journey:

Setting Realistic Goals

Start by setting small, achievable goals.

Instead of aiming to be fluent in a month, target learning basic greetings or mastering a certain number of vocabulary words each week.

This helps build confidence and keeps you motivated.

Make sure your goals are specific, measurable, and time-bound.

For example, aim to learn 20 new words every week or complete one lesson per day.

Track your progress to see how far you’ve come.

Adjust your goals as you advance to keep them challenging yet attainable.

Regular Practice and Immersion

Regular practice is essential.

Dedicate a specific time each day to practice Spanish.

Even 15-30 minutes daily can lead to significant improvement over time.

Consistency is key.

Involve immersion by listening to Spanish music, watching Spanish shows, or reading simple Spanish books.

Try to think in Spanish and practice speaking with native speakers if possible.

Immersion helps you get used to the rhythms and patterns of the language, making it easier to understand and communicate.

Utilizing Supplementary Resources

Use a variety of resources to enhance your learning.

Free tools like language apps, podcasts, and YouTube channels offer diverse learning methods.

For a comprehensive approach, consider structured programs like Lingoda or Coursera.

Workbooks, flashcards, and online exercises can reinforce what you learn in classes.

Join online communities or forums where you can ask questions, share experiences, and get support from other learners.

Always expand your resource base to cover different aspects of the language and keep your practice engaging and effective.